To reset a Logitech device, you can typically follow these steps: Unplug the device for about 10 seconds, then reconnect. For wireless keyboards and mice, remove the batteries for a similar time. If resetting a Logitech Harmony remote, access the MyHarmony desktop software, select your remote, and choose ‘Restore.’ For other specific Logitech products, refer to the user manual or the Logitech support website for precise instructions. This helps restore default settings and resolve common connectivity issues.
